What is the Occupational Health and Safety Act?

The Occupational Health and Safety Act is legislation that outlines the legal obligations of employers and employees regarding health and safety in the workplace, for South Africa. The OHS Act sets out minimum requirements for workplace safety and provides a framework for SafetyWallet subscribers to create and maintain a safe working environment.

Why is staying up to date with health and safety legislative changes important?

Staying up to date with health and safety legislative changes is important for SafetyWallet subscribers to ensure that they remain up to date with current OHS legislation and provide their employees with a safe and healthy working environment to ensure OHS compliance. Failure to comply with health and safety legislation can result in legal and financial consequences for any employer.
